Output 907c68fc52a153ca4310408985d8cdfc9e105eb93afee8c3a74f8e86824d90c8:0

value
154350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420afc0b68158dccc28b1f5904354c1c32370d07 OP_EQUAL
address
37iDgRZy5ZtMz2ds1WxotX258gYv5cJHSN
transaction
907c68fc52a153ca4310408985d8cdfc9e105eb93afee8c3a74f8e86824d90c8
spent
true